What is angular 2?
Why angular 2 is better than angular Js1?
What is typescript?
What is observable and give an example in Angular 2?
What is promises and give an example in Angular 2?
What is ECMAScript?
What is Ngoninit in Angular2?
What is ngOnDestroy in Angular2 and when it is called?

What is angular 2?

AngularJS is a TypeScript framework to build large scale and highly efficient wb application.
It has following features
1. Components
2. TypeScript
3. Services

Why angular 2 is better than angular Js1 ?

  • Angular 2 is mobile oriented, so using by this language we can build (Native/Hybrid) mobile apps.
  • Angular 2 Having Better performance than angular 1.x.
  • Angular 2 provides more choice for languages.
  • Angular 2 implements web standards like components whereas angular was controllers and $scope.
  • Angular 2, directly uses the valid HTML DOM element properties and events.
  • Angular 2 Support TypeScript which providing amazing features like auto-completion, static types,etc.
  • Angular 2 Routers concept has been optimised which can have good performance for navigation in the modern web browser.

What is typescript?

TypeScript is a superset of JavaScript which basically provides option for static typing, classes and interfaces. One of the great feature of TypeScript  is to enable IDEs to provide a richer environment for spotting common errors as you type the code.

